The Zander Font: Bold, Stylish, and Business Ready

If you're running a small business, branding is more than just a logo or a website—it's about creating a visual identity that speaks to your customers. One of the most powerful tools in your design arsenal is the right font. The Zander is a display font with a distinctive blackletter style, offering both regular and italic versions. Its bold, intricate cuts give it a strong personality that can elevate your brand across every touchpoint.

As a small business owner, I've learned that consistency is key. Using The Zander consistently across your materials—whether it's on a product label, a social media post, or a menu—helps build recognition and trust. It’s not just about looking good; it’s about making your brand feel professional and intentional.

What Makes The Zander Stand Out

The Zander has a unique look that blends tradition with modernity. Its blackletter roots give it an old-world charm, while its clean structure makes it versatile for contemporary designs. Each letter has a sharp, deliberate cut that adds character without overwhelming the design. This font works well when you want to make a statement but still keep things readable.

It includes uppercase and lowercase letters, numbers, and punctuation, making it suitable for a wide range of applications. Whether you’re designing a logo, crafting a tagline, or creating a packaging label, The Zander offers the flexibility you need without sacrificing style.

Using The Zander Effectively

One of the first things to consider is where and how you’ll use The Zander. As a display font, it shines in headlines, logos, and large text elements. However, it’s not ideal for body copy due to its intricate details, which can reduce readability on small screens or printed materials.

Test The Zander in different sizes and contexts before committing to it for your entire brand. Try it on a business card, a social media thumbnail, or a product label to see how it performs. If it looks great in those scenarios, it’s likely a good fit for your broader design strategy.

When pairing fonts, think about balance. A decorative font like The Zander pairs well with a clean, neutral typeface. For instance, using it alongside a standard serif or sans serif font can create a harmonious look that’s both eye-catching and easy to read.
